The co-author networks are important type of social network. In this paper, we establishes the Erdös co-author network and proves that the Erdös co-author network is a complex network which has three main properties, including small world, scale-free and clustering properties. Besides, this article gives the calculation formulas for degree centrality, closeness centrality and betweenness centrality of a network. According to the calculation result we give a ranking order for authors within Erdös co-author network.

The thesis deals with contemporary author's law which is effective in Czech republic in relation to a piece of music and its legal protection. The goal of first chapters is to outline the crucial statutes concerning subjects as authors, executive artists and recording producers. A great deal of the thesis concerns with internet music piracy which results from a mass file-sharing. It also includes an evalution of current author's law and its efficiency in today's information society.
